I have read babies cry more in yellow rooms and tempers fly there as well. I always limit my use of yellow in a baby quilt. Studies have also shown babies like to look at high contrast of colors, which is why you see alot of black and white toys for infants. Black and white may be a boring quilt but you could use other dark to white contrasts. There are no rules though, use what you like or ask the Mother for her color preferences. To keep the quilt safe don't attach anything the baby can pluck out and put in its mouth, like buttons or attached ribbons.
